Savannah's Iconic Dishes

1. Lowcountry Boil

When it comes to quintessential Savannah cuisine, the Lowcountry Boil takes the crown. This one-pot wonder brings together fresh shrimp, crab, sausage, corn, and potatoes, all boiled and seasoned to perfection with a blend of spices. Served family-style, it's a feast that brings people together – where laughter flows as freely as the savory aromas.

2. She-Crab Soup

Indulge in a bowl of She-Crab Soup, a rich and creamy delicacy made from blue crab meat, crab roe, heavy cream, and a dash of sherry. Its velvety texture and exquisite flavor have made it a Savannah favorite since the early 1900s. Don't miss the opportunity to savor this iconic dish during your visit.

3. Fried Green Tomatoes

A true Southern classic, Fried Green Tomatoes are a must-try when in Savannah. Slices of unripe tomatoes are breaded, fried to a golden crisp, and served with a tangy remoulade sauce. The contrast between the tartness of the tomatoes and the crunchy coating is simply irresistible.

Culinary Hotspots: Where to Indulge

Exploring Savannah's food scene is an adventure in itself. From cozy family-run eateries to upscale restaurants, the city offers endless options to satisfy every craving. While strolling River Street, be sure to visit The Olde Pink House, a historic mansion turned restaurant, known for its Southern-inspired dishes and charming ambiance.

If you're looking for a taste of Savannah's soul food and delicious fried chicken, make your way to Mrs. Wilkes Dining Room. This local institution has been serving mouthwatering comfort food for generations, prepared with love and served in a family-style setting.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can you recommend any vegetarian options in Savannah?

A: Absolutely! While Savannah is famous for its seafood and meat-based dishes, it also offers a variety of vegetarian options. Local eateries like Fox & Fig Cafe and The Sentient Bean specialize in plant-based cuisine, offering tasty alternatives for vegetarian and vegan food lovers.

Q: Are there any food festivals or events in Savannah worth attending?

A: Savannah is known for its lively food festivals. The Savannah Food and Wine Festival held in November is a must-visit for food enthusiasts. This week-long event features cooking demonstrations, tastings, and culinary competitions, showcasing the best of Savannah's culinary talent.

Q: Where can I find the best seafood in Savannah?

A: If you're craving fresh seafood, The Crab Shack is a popular spot where you can enjoy a casual dining experience alongside a picturesque marsh view. They offer an extensive menu of seafood dishes ranging from shrimp and oysters to succulent crab legs.

Q: Can I sample Savannah's cuisine on a budget?

A: Absolutely! Savannah provides a range of budget-friendly options without compromising on taste. Local food trucks like BowTie Barbecue Co. offer affordable and delicious street food, allowing you to savor the city's flavors without breaking the bank.
